The three types of academic vocabulary focused on in the SIOP model include: -----------, -------------, and --------------
Content words Process/function words Words that teach English structure
400
List Bloom’s taxonomy from lowest to highest.
What is Remember, Understand, Apply, Analyze, Evaluate, and Create?

State 3 ways to clarify key concepts in text/lecture for ESL students?
A. To use texts written in their home language as well as English, to allow native English speaking students to mentor/tutor the ESL student through the text, and to use visuals to support language.

Identify the 6 stages of the effective teaching cycle.
1- Develop lesson using assessments, standards, and SIOP Model 2- Teach lessons 3- Assess comprehension 4- Review Key Concept and Vocabulary 5- Make adjustments 6- Reteach
